Gulf Nations Unite

Gulf Nations Unite

In a show of unity and solidarity, **Gulf countries** have come together to express their unwavering support for Kuwait's sovereignty after Iraq submitted new maritime coordinates to the United Nations. This move has sparked concerns about the region's territorial integrity and has prompted a strong response from Kuwait's neighbors.

Regional Response

Qatar, Bahrain, Oman, Saudi Arabia, and the UAE have all issued statements reiterating their commitment to Kuwait's territorial rights and condemning any attempts to undermine its sovereignty. This united front is a testament to the strong bonds of cooperation and friendship that exist among the Gulf nations.
